2. Safety Information

Before beginning installation or operation, please read and understand all safety instructions. Failure to follow these instructions could result in electric shock, fire, or personal injury.

  • Always disconnect power at the main circuit breaker before installing or servicing the fan.
  • Ensure all electrical connections comply with local codes and ordinances, as well as the National Electrical Code (NEC). If you are unfamiliar with electrical wiring, consult a qualified electrician.
  • The fan must be mounted to a structurally sound ceiling joist or outlet box capable of supporting the fan's weight (approximately 22.8 lbs).
  • Maintain a minimum clearance of 7 feet from the floor to the bottom of the fan blades.
  • Do not bend the blade brackets during installation or cleaning.
  • Avoid placing objects in the path of the fan blades.

5. Operating Instructions

Your Hartland ceiling fan is controlled using two pull chains:

  • Fan Speed Control: One pull chain controls the fan speed. Pull the chain repeatedly to cycle through High, Medium, Low, and Off settings. The fan features a 3-speed WhisperWind motor for quiet operation.
  • Light Control: The second pull chain controls the integrated LED light kit. Pull the chain to turn the lights On or Off.
  • Reversible Motor: For year-round comfort, the fan motor is reversible. A switch on the motor housing allows you to change the direction of blade rotation. In warm weather, set the fan to rotate counter-clockwise to create a downdraft cooling effect. In cool weather, set it to rotate clockwise to create an updraft, circulating warm air near the ceiling.

6. Maintenance

Regular maintenance ensures optimal performance and longevity of your ceiling fan.

  • Cleaning: Use a soft brush or lint-free cloth to clean the fan blades and motor housing. Do not use abrasive cleaners or solvents, as these can damage the finish.
  • Light Bulb Replacement: The fan uses energy-efficient LED bulbs. When replacement is necessary, ensure the power is off before unscrewing the old bulb and installing a new one of the same type and wattage.
  • Tightening Fasteners: Periodically check all screws and fasteners for tightness. Over time, vibrations can cause them to loosen.

7. Troubleshooting

If you experience issues with your fan, consult the following common troubleshooting steps:

ProblemPossible CauseSolution
Fan does not startNo power to the fan; loose wire connections; motor switch in wrong position.Check circuit breaker/fuse; ensure all connections are secure; verify motor reverse switch is fully engaged.
Fan wobblesLoose blade screws; unbalanced blades; loose mounting bracket.Tighten all blade screws; use a balancing kit (if provided); ensure mounting bracket is securely fastened.
Light does not workLoose bulb; faulty bulb; loose wire connection in light kit.Tighten bulb; replace bulb; check light kit wiring connections.
Noisy operationLoose screws; motor housing rubbing; blades hitting an obstruction.Check and tighten all screws; ensure no wires are rubbing against the motor; verify blade clearance.

8. Specifications

FeatureDetail
BrandHunter
Model NameHartland
Model Number50311
ColorNoble Bronze
Fan Size52 inches
Product Dimensions52"D x 52"W x 19.49"H
Number of Blades5
Light KitIncluded, with Clear Seeded Glass Shades
Bulb TypeLED (Edison style)
Control MethodPull Chain
Motor TypeAC Motor (WhisperWind)
Air Flow Capacity3938 Cubic Feet Per Minute
Wattage44 watts
Item Weight22.8 pounds
Indoor/Outdoor UsageIndoor
